Introduction
SugarCRM provides an extensive web services SOAP API for integration with external applications. This article introduces how to use .NET-based SOAPSonar Enterprise Edition for invoking SugarCRM SOAP-API. The following simple steps are required to get started:
▪ Install SOAPSonar Enterprise Edition published by Crosscheck Networks.
▪ Sign-up for SugarCRM evaluation License.
▪ Load WSDL published by SugarCRM
▪ Setup Operations, e.g., List Module Fields.
With these simple steps, you will be ready to integrate SugarCRM with any web services-aware application. The web services API provided by SugarCRM is extensive, easy-to-use, and flexible.
